About Dauphin County, Pennsylvania
Dauphin County, Pennsylvania has a total population of 289,593, making it the 249th most populous county in the United States. The median age in Dauphin County is 39.4 years, which is 1.3% above the national median of 38.9 years.
The median household income in Dauphin County is $76,242, which ranks #765 of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 1.5% above the national median of $75,149. The poverty rate is 12.9%, higher than the national rate of 12.6%. The unemployment rate stands at 4.5%.
The median home value in Dauphin County is $236,400, 16.1% below the national median. Renters in Dauphin County pay a median gross rent of $1,217 per month. The homeownership rate is 63.1%, compared to the national rate of 64.4%.
In Dauphin County, 34.4%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her, 2.2% above the national average of 33.7%. Health insurance coverage stands at 93.6% of the population. The average commute time for workers is 23.5 min.
Dauphin County is a diverse community. The largest racial or ethnic group is White (non-Hispanic) at 60.6% of the population, followed by Black (non-Hispanic) (16.3%) and Hispanic or Latino (11.8%).
All data for Dauphin County, Pennsylvania com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ates.
